kevkiev Posted July 20, 2012 Share Posted July 20, 2012 Might be interesting to go into console and type: sqs TG03 to see if the game recognizes that you've done dampened spirits (though it seems you have the journal that indicates it is, so maybe this is off base). You'll get a list of the various stages, and completed ones will have "1" beside them. The last stage is 200. If, by some chance, you have a zero beside 200 (ie game doesn't recognize the quest as complete) you can complete the whole quest through console by typing: setstage TG03 200 Anyways, if the game does recognize the 3rd quest as done and you're facing glitch only in scoundrel's folly, you should be able to skip the first part of that quest (ie speaking to Mercer) by typing while in console: setstage TG04 10 which should mark that stage as complete and trigger the next stage of the quest Link to comment Share on other sites More sharing options...
